Improved rock wool insulation board cutting equipment assembly
Technical Field
The invention relates to the technical field of rock wool insulation board cutting equipment, in particular to an improved rock wool insulation board cutting equipment assembly.
Background
The rock wool heat insulation board is prepared by melting basalt and other natural ores as main raw materials, throwing and drawing a high-temperature solution of the basalt into discontinuous fibers with the diameter of 4-7 mu m by adopting an international advanced four-roller centrifugal cotton manufacturing process, adding a certain amount of binder, dustproof oil and water repellent into the rock wool fibers, settling, curing, cutting and the like, and preparing series products with different densities according to different purposes, wherein the rock wool heat insulation board product is suitable for heat insulation, sound insulation and the like of industrial equipment, buildings, ships.
Rock wool heated board is in the course of working, generally need use cutting equipment to cut into a plurality of modules with rock wool heated board, and the anchor clamps that are used for carrying out the centre gripping to rock wool heated board on the current cutting equipment generally are manual anchor clamps, consequently in the course of working, need the workman to carry out manual clamping.
Disclosure of Invention
The invention aims to overcome the problems in the prior art and provides an improved rock wool insulation board cutting equipment assembly which can solve the problems in the prior art to at least a certain extent.
In order to achieve the technical purpose and achieve the technical effect, the invention is realized by the following technical scheme:
the utility model provides an improved generation rock wool heated board cutting equipment subassembly, includes the base of horizontal installation on external cutting equipment, be equipped with a fixing base on the base, fixing base top surface level is equipped with a locating plate that is used for placing the rock wool heated board, be equipped with fixture on the base, fixture is including the riser of locating base length direction both ends, the riser upper end articulates there is the rotation support, the free end level of rotation support articulates there is the free bearing, the free bearing bottom surface is equipped with the clamp plate, the rotation support is by its edge of rotation unit drive and the articulated department of riser rotates, makes two the relative both ends of rock wool heated board are pushed down respectively to the clamp plate.
As a further optimization of the above technical solution, the rotation unit includes a rotation shaft horizontally rotatably connected to the fixing base, two ends of the rotation shaft in the length direction are respectively provided with a first thread portion and a second thread portion, which have opposite thread turning directions, the first thread portion and the second thread portion are respectively sleeved with a nut seat, the nut seat is hinged with a hinge rod, and the two hinge rods are respectively hinged with the two rotation brackets.
As a further optimization of the above technical solution, the rotating shaft is driven to rotate by a servo motor installed on one of the vertical plates.
As a further optimization of the technical scheme, the rotating shaft is suitable for being rotatably connected to the fixed seat through the mounting bearing.
As a further optimization of the above technical solution, the top surface of the positioning plate is provided with a plurality of first ratchet grooves crossing the width direction thereof.
As a further optimization of the above technical solution, a plurality of second ratchet grooves which are communicated with the first ratchet grooves and are perpendicular to each other in length direction are arranged at the middle position of the positioning plate.
The invention has the beneficial effects that: the rotating support is driven to rotate along the hinged part with the vertical plate by the rotating unit, so that the pressing plate clamps the surface of the rock wool heat insulation plate, the hinged support is arranged to be hinged on the rotating support, the pressing plate can be enabled to float and compress the rock wool heat insulation plate, further, the situation that clamping is unstable due to the fact that the surface of the rock wool heat insulation plate is uneven is avoided, the rotating unit is arranged, the rotating shaft is driven by the servo motor to rotate, the two nut seats move relatively, further, the two hinge rods drive the two rotating supports to rotate, the structure is simple, the cost is low, the action synchronism of the two rotating supports is good, the first ratchet groove is arranged, the rock wool heat insulation plate is not prone to sliding after being compressed by the pressing plate, the second ratchet groove is arranged in the middle of the positioning plate, the friction force between the bottom surface of the rock wool heat insulation plate and the surface of the positioning plate, on the other hand, first thorn groove and second thorn groove intersection produce the sunken of breach form for cutting equipment can cushion in going into sunken through rock wool heated board bottom outer wall extrusion to the cutting force vibration of rock wool heated board, promptly, and rock wool heated board bottom outer wall certain buffering space is given in sunken, consequently has reduced the production of noise to a certain extent at least.

Detailed Description
In order to make the technical means, the creation characteristics, the achievement purposes and the effects of the invention easy to understand, the techn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, but not all the embodiments. All other embodiments, which can be derived by a person skilled in the art from the embodiments given herein without making any creative effort, shall fall within the protection scope of the present invention.
Referring to fig. 1-4, fig. 1-4 show an improved rock wool heat preservation board cutting device assembly, which includes a base 4 horizontally installed on an external cutting device, a fixing seat 2 is installed on the base 4, a positioning plate 13 for placing a rock wool heat preservation board is horizontally installed on the top surface of the fixing seat 2, a plurality of first ratchet grooves 12 crossing the width direction of the positioning plate 13 are installed on the top surface of the positioning plate 13, a plurality of second ratchet grooves 14 which are communicated with the first ratchet grooves 12 and are mutually perpendicular to the length direction are installed at the middle position of the positioning plate 13, a clamping mechanism is installed on the base 4, the clamping mechanism includes vertical plates 7 installed on both ends of the base 4 in the length direction, a rotating bracket 8 is hinged to the upper end of each vertical plate 7, a hinge seat 10 is horizontally hinged to the free end of the rotating bracket 8, a pressing plate 11 is installed on the bottom surface of the hinge seat 10, the rotating bracket 8 is driven by a rotating unit to, the two pressing plates 11 are enabled to press the two opposite ends of the rock wool heat-insulation plate respectively, the rotating unit comprises a rotating shaft which is suitable for being horizontally and rotatably connected onto the fixing seat 2 through a mounting bearing, a first thread portion 1 and a second thread portion 3 with opposite thread turning directions are arranged at the two ends of the rotating shaft in the length direction respectively, a nut seat 5 is sleeved on each of the first thread portion 1 and the second thread portion 3 in a threaded manner, a hinge rod 9 is hinged onto the nut seat 5, the hinge rods 9 are hinged with the two rotating supports 8 respectively, and the rotating shaft is driven to rotate by a servo motor 6 arranged on one vertical plate 7.
When the invention is used: lay rock wool heated board flat and place on the locating plate, switch on external power source, start servo motor, servo motor rotates, and the drive shaft rotates, and then makes two nut seat relative movement, and the nut seat removes the in-process, makes the hinge lever pulling rotate the support along rotating with the articulated department of riser, and then makes the clamp plate move down and compress tightly the top surface of rock wool heated board, and outside cutting equipment can carry out the cutting operation.
